Job Description

Are you ready to join an impactful team and lead a digital product at the heart of the Product Management team at The LEGO Group? Are you eager to enable the LEGO sales organization, elevate our commercial momentum and succeed with our retailers?

Bring your digital and retail expertise to the table to help the LEGO Group build a cutting-edge Retail Execution strategy and shaping the organisation’s commercial actions.

We are step-changing our in-store execution ecosystem with core capabilities to drive productivity and protecting our brand. We are therefore looking for an experienced Product Manager to hold a leading role in building our digital Retail execution capabilities, in strong collaboration with commercial teams.

Core Responsibilities

  • Develop an ambitious and clear product vision and communicate it effectively to relevant stakeholders and the team, so they’re aligned, and invested in the strategic direction

  • Translate product strategy into a product roadmap, identifying and generating new ideas that grow market share, drive commercial and business value and improve customer experience

  • Define, monitor and report the product teams quarterly objectives and key results performance, in line with our portfolio strategic objectives and key results, and wider market context

  • Lead product discovery with the team, researchers and wider stakeholders to develop, experiment and test new ideas that help shape the value proposition

  • Work closely with the product team and relevant stakeholders to ensure that the product is continually improved to deliver better outcomes for customers and shoppers.

  • Drive end-to-end team output strategy from inception to production

  • Integrate usability studies and research into product requirements to enhance user satisfaction and ensure customer-driven design 

  • Ensure communication around priorities, developments and changes are clearly understood by stakeholders across the business

  • Plan product development out into future by e.g maintaining a backlog 3 to 4 sprints ahead of the team

  • Successfully identify risks and mitigations that remove risk and uncertainty early in product development

  • Promote and encourage a continuous delivery culture within the product team, with focus on releasing value incrementally to deliver against objectives and key results

  • Act as a subject matter expert for the product team, providing insight, context and additional information as needed to help understanding of what is required

Play your part in our team succeeding

We are accelerating our digital agenda to establish a more seamless experience for our customers, improving how we protect and promote the LEGO brand online and in stores, and how we better enable our sales and marketing colleagues to engage with our customers.

This role will be centrally located in the global Markets & Channels organization as part of Global Commercial Development (GCD) across our B2B Market Groups and D2C LEGO Retail unit with a mandate to optimise commercial momentum, support group-wide commercial strategies and drive commercial insights and capability building in how we activate and protect our brand and go to market.

As a Product Manager for Retail Execution, you are accountable for the success of your product, setting the product vision and strategy, defining objectives and key results for the product team, in close alignment with your stakeholders. You will develop a deep understanding of market conditions and the needs of key stakeholders through research and analytics and collaborates closely with various stakeholders to develop new opportunities that improve our Retail Execution in store and enable markets to make ideal in-store execution decisions.

Do you have what it takes?

  • Strong communication & collaboration skills as you will work with stakeholders across the entire organization including LEGO Retail, Product Development, Finance, Sales & Marketing

  • Understand the commerce business in general (sales operation, field sales management, merchandising, key account management)

  • Ensure effective leadership of the team; maintaining a continuous learning environment, setting clear objectives to ensure there is clarity on what needs to be achieved for any given work

  • Offer a supportive coaching style, proactively encouraging personal and professional development and achievement across the product team

  • Experience with engaging and working with cross-functional teams (from tech and design to business) as well as agile development methodologies, storytelling and evangelism

  • Open to occasional travel - 10-15 international travel days per year should be expected.
